Arnold’s Soft Naturals Bread Review

A while ago, Rena sent me some Arnold breads to sample. Myself and my roommate (and her boyfriend :) ) have consumed this bread in various forms to test it out.

Arnold Soft 100% Whole Wheat

According to the website, Arnold Soft 100% Whole Wheat is:

  • A good source of fiber
  • Cholesterol free
  • No HFCS
  • Made with whole grains
  • Zero trans fat

My take: I think first, it’s worth to say what I look for in a bread, other than good nutritional value. I love breads that are dense, not too soft and that are multidimensional (great as toast, with PB & J and regular sandwiches). With that said, I thought this bread was okay. My roommate used it to make a sandwich and was not satisfied…she described it as “spongy.” It also got soggy pretty fast when I packed a sandwich with it. I am not really a fan of the texture.

Arnold 100% Soft Honey Wheat

According to the website, this bread is also:

  • A good source of fiber
  • Cholesterol free
  • HFCS free
  • Zero trans fat
  • Made with whole grains

My take: This bread had a nice sweet kick to it but its texture is also spongy and chewy. It goes well with PB & J because of the slight honey taste but I wouldn’t make other kinds of sandwiches (such as with tofu or deli meat) with it. My roommate also wasn’t impressed by this loaf any more than the first one.

Bottom line: I wouldn’t go out and buy this bread. Not only because I don’t like the texture and feel that it lacks bread versatility, but because I think Arnold offers other products that have awesome nutritional value, amazing taste and texture.

So, overall this bread isn’t bad, it just doesn’t fit my tastes. If you are a fan of spongy and soft breads, I would recommend using it to make toast, French toast or bread putting. I would not recommend it for deli meat/hummus/tofu/etc. sandwiches.
